Transaction e568cb66449028bf54264ec42f57c124704673d72d54d3d1f4c99f8b832da8ce
1 Input
1 Output
-
e568cb66449028bf54264ec42f57c124704673d72d54d3d1f4c99f8b832da8ce:0
- value
- 1075171
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57af364aa74a40cad7d932ea96ccba306317ccc4 OP_EQUAL
- address
- 39gecBUqyd3DtQMGQFR5uvxdfbrLBjq6aF